Preparation
- In a large bowl, dissolve the sugar and yeast in warm water, then let it sit for 5-10 minutes until foamy.
- Stir in the olive oil and salt, then gradually add the flour, mixing until a shaggy dough forms.
- Transfer the dough to a lightly floured surface and knead for 5-7 minutes until smooth and elastic.
Rising
- Lightly grease a large bowl with olive oil, place the dough in it, and turn to coat.
-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and place it in a warm, draft-free spot for 45-60 minutes, or until doubled in size.
Shaping and Baking
- Gently punch down the risen dough and divide it into two equal portions.
- On a lightly floured surface, roll or stretch each portion into a 12-inch round pizza crust.
- Add your desired toppings and bake according to your pizza recipe's instructions.
Notes
Ensure your water is the correct temperature for activating the yeast. For a crispier crust, preheat your pizza stone or baking steel before placing the pizza on it.
